About Gastops: Moving You since 1979

Over the last 47 years, Gastops has built a robust business which is recognized worldwide for its innovative contributions to equipment health management in the aviation, energy, marine, industrial and transportation industries. Gastops’ products and services add value throughout the life cycle of complex critical equipment from the design stage through to in-service operations and support. We design, manufacture, and support advanced equipment sensing and analysis products, including on-line oil debris sensors, torque measurement sensors, turbine blade health sensors, and at-line oil analysis systems.

What You’ll Do:

The Quality Assurance Inspector will be part of the Quality Assurance team with the primary focus of inspecting products. You will;

  • Inspect in-process and finished products for all lines to ensure products meet customer specifications and company quality standards.
  • Complete necessary quality control documentation.
  • Perform regular routine audit inspections when required to do so.
  • Document inspection findings, including defects or deviations and ensure verifications are performed when rework is completed
  • Monitor and meet required production inspection targets.
  • Train new inspectors as required.
  • Participate in team quality meeting(s) and provide feedback to team on issues identified after troubleshooting.
  • Participate in quality improvement initiatives.
  • Perform any other duties as assigned by the supervisor.

Please note that this job description is not meant to be an all-inclusive statement of every duty and responsibility that will ever be required of an employee in the job.

Who You Are:

  • Knowledge of AS9100 Quality System Requirements
  • Experience interpreting drawings, technical documents, purchase orders, etc.
  • Worked with IPC-A-610, IPC-A-620, IPC-J-STD-001 is preferred
  • Experience using a wide variety of precision measuring instruments (i.e. micrometers, calipers, indicators, etc)
  • Strong understanding and application of workmanship standards
  • Strong understanding of GD&T
  • Great understanding and application of quality standards and control procedures

About Gastops

Transportation Equipment Manufacturing
51-200

Gastops designs, manufactures and supports advanced equipment health sensing and analysis products, including on-line oil debris sensors, torque measurement sensors, turbine blade health sensors, and at-line wear debris analyzers. Additionally, we offer a wide range of specialized technical and engineering services to assist in the development of equipment control and monitoring systems, and maintenance of mission-critical assets.

We have applied our equipment condition analysis engineering capabilities to develop and execute fleet maintenance programs which transform maintenance from the traditional scheduled or reactive maintenance, to a more proactive condition based approach. This approach has also exposed us to the industry need to provide high performance, responsive, maintenance, repair and overhaul services for high value aviation components.

For 40 years, our solutions have been used in Defense, Aerospace, Energy and Marine applications to optimize the availability, productivity, maintenance, performance and safety of mission-critical assets. We offer peace of mind to our customers by supporting the equipment that helps their aircraft fly, ships sail, trains roll, generators generate, and turbines turn.
